But the Memphis rapper's hit single "F.N.F. ," which certified her status as a star in mainstream hip hop, only came out a year ago, in April 2022. Since then, we've had our eye on the rapper and the glorious inches of hair she tends to wear. We almost didn't recognize the star when she posted herself on March 19 with neon red waves that were damn near longer than a CVS receipt.
The Grammy-nominated artist paired her butt-length, fire-engine-red waves with a shimmery teal two-piece set and tons of blinged-out jewelry. Hairstylistinstalled the unit with a series of cornrows on the topmost section of hair. We love how the braided pieces looked within the textured hair. It's that wavy texture we honestly can't get enough of.
